This is ‘The Irish Roar‘ – the country’s official Euro 2016 song. It’s performed by Seo Linn and features a lovely tribute to the late Bill O’Herlihy.
It’s well worth a listen and will certainly get you in the mood for the summer.

Jose Mourinho‘s next game at Old Trafford?
You’ve guessed it – Soccer Aid 2016, when he’ll manage an England team comprised of ‘celebrities’ like Olly Murs, Jack Whitewall and Jonathan Wilkes – y’know, that guy who’s known for being Robbie Williams’ best friend.
Anyway, ‘The Special One’ has been in attendance before – in 2014 – when he famously and delightfully put Murs on his arse.
